Hello , Refers to rc.conf(5) the alternative way for cloning interfaces is by using create_args_<interface> variable In rc.conf there is a typo error in variable name --- /etc/defaults/rc.conf.orig 2010-08-25 11:01:12.000000000 +0300 +++ /etc/defaults/rc.conf 2010-08-25 11:01:29.000000000 +0300 @@ -212,7 +212,7 @@ #ifconfig_ed0_ipx="ipx 0x00010010" # Sample IPX address family entry. #ifconfig_fxp0_name="net0" # Change interface name from fxp0 to net0. #vlans_fxp0="101 vlan0" # vlan(4) interfaces for fxp0 device -#create_arg_vlan0="vlan 102" # vlan tag for vlan0 device +#create_args_vlan0="vlan 102" # vlan tag for vlan0 device #wlans_ath0="wlan0" # wlan(4) interfaces for ath0 device #wlandebug_wlan0="scan+auth+assoc" # Set debug flags with wlanddebug(8) #ipv4_addrs_fxp0="192.168.0.1/24 192.168.1.1-5/28" # example IPv4 address entry.
